NREF vs REFI
NREF: A REIT that sources and manages real estate debt financing backed by commercial property across diversified markets. REFI: A mortgage REIT that originates and invests in first-lien commercial real estate loans, generating income through interest and origination fees while maintaining a diversified portfolio of non-agency mortgages.
